Storm brings rain, wind, cool temperatures eastward
A powerful storm is set to traverse the United States, bringing widespread rain, gusty winds, and unseasonably cool temperatures to the eastern part of the country later this week. Forecasters predict rainfall amounts of one to two inches from the Gulf Coast all the way up to New England. The Outer Banks region is particularly vulnerable, with strong winds expected to exacerbate coastal erosion.
